How do you design a fence to withstand high winds here?

The design wind speed for County Center is 115 MPH V-ult. This engineering standard from ASCE 7-22 dictates post spacing, concrete footing size, and the use of through-bolt or torsion-post brackets. Proper design prevents failure during peak storm season gusts, which are channeled by structures near the Prince William County Government Center.

What fence materials hold up best against termites and soil corrosion in this area?

Given the moderate to heavy termite risk and moderate soil corrosivity, use pressure-treated wood rated for ground contact or vinyl composites. All metal fasteners and brackets must be G90 galvanized steel to prevent rust streaks. Avoid untreated wood posts directly in soil.

What are the height and setback rules for fences in my neighborhood?

County Center zoning enforces a 4-foot height limit in front yards and 6 feet in rear yards. A 0-foot setback is allowed on side and rear property lines. For corner lots, maintain a clear 'sight triangle' by keeping fences under 3 feet high within 25 feet of the intersection, especially near I-95 for driver visibility.

Why do fence posts in Old Town need to be set so deep?

The frost line in County Center is 24 inches. Posts must be set at least 6 inches below this line to prevent frost heave, which lifts and racks fences. Following IRC Section R403.1.4 for footings in frost-susceptible soils is non-negotiable for structural stability.

What is required before you dig fence post holes?

Virginia 811 must be contacted at least three business days before excavation. Hitting a utility line in Old Town carries major liability and repair costs.
